Rasulpur

Rasulpur is a village located in Saidpur tehsil of Ghazipur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Saidpur (tehsildar office) and 62km away from district headquarter Ghazipur. As per 2009 stats, Nasirpur Khas is the gram panchayat of Rasulpur village.

About Rasulp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Rasulpur is 204120. The village spans a total geographical area of 16.05 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 233221. Saidapur is nearest town to Rasulp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.

Population of Rasulpur

According to the 2011 Census, Rasulpur has a total population of about 20, with approximately 10 males and 10 females. The sex ratio is around 1000 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 5 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 4 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 65.00%, with male literacy at about 70.00% and female literacy near 60.00%. There are around 3 households in the village. Connectivity of Rasulp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Rasulpur. As per the 2011 stats, Rasulp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
